Tubular Structure Segmentation Based on Minimal Path Method and Anisotropic Enhancement

We present a new interactive method for tubular structure extraction. The main application and motivation for this work is vessel tracking in 2D and 3D images. The basic tools are minimal paths solved using the fast marching algorithm. This allows interactive tools for the physician by clicking on a small number of points in order to obtain a minimal path between two points or a set of paths in the case of a tree structure. Our method is based on a variant of the minimal path method that models the vessel as a centerline and surface. This is done by adding one dimension for the local radius around the centerline. The crucial step of our method is the definition of the local metrics to minimize. We have chosen to exploit the tubular structure of the vessels one wants to extract to built an anisotropic metric. The designed metric is well oriented along the direction of the vessel, admits higher velocity on the centerline, and provides a good estimate of the vessel radius. Based on the optimally oriented flux this measure is required to be robust against the disturbance introduced by noise or adjacent structures with intensity similar to the target vessel. We obtain promising results on noisy synthetic and real 2D and 3D images and we present a clinical validation.

[1]  Tony F. Chan,et al.  Active contours without edges , 2001, IEEE Trans. Image Process..

[2]  Max A. Viergever,et al.  Vessel enhancing diffusion: A scale space representation of vessel structures , 2006, Medical Image Anal..

[3]  J. Sethian,et al.  Fast methods for the Eikonal and related Hamilton- Jacobi equations on unstructured meshes. , 2000, Proceedings of the National Academy of Sciences of the United States of America.

[4]  Joachim Weickert,et al.  Coherence-Enhancing Diffusion Filtering , 1999, International Journal of Computer Vision.

[5]  J A Sethian,et al.  A fast marching level set method for monotonically advancing fronts. , 1996, Proceedings of the National Academy of Sciences of the United States of America.

[6]  Isabelle Bloch,et al.  Bayesian Maximal Paths for Coronary Artery Segmentation from 3D CT Angiograms , 2009, MICCAI.

[7]  Anthony J. Yezzi,et al.  Vessels as 4-D Curves: Global Minimal 4-D Paths to Extract 3-D Tubular Surfaces and Centerlines , 2007, IEEE Transactions on Medical Imaging.

[8]  Laurent D. Cohen,et al.  Fast extraction of minimal paths in 3D images and applications to virtual endoscopy , 2001, Medical Image Anal..

[9]  P. Lions Generalized Solutions of Hamilton-Jacobi Equations , 1982 .

[10]  E. Rouy,et al.  A viscosity solutions approach to shape-from-shading , 1992 .

[11]  Ken Masamune,et al.  A Variational Method for Geometric Regularization of Vascular Segmentation in Medical Images , 2008, IEEE Transactions on Image Processing.

[12]  L. Cohen,et al.  Geodesic Methods for Shape and Surface Processing , 2009 .

[13]  Max W. K. Law,et al.  Segmentation of Vessels Using Weighted Local Variances and an Active contour Model , 2006, 2006 Conference on Computer Vision and Pattern Recognition Workshop (CVPRW'06).

[14]  Nicholas Ayache,et al.  Directional Anisotropic Diffusion Applied to Segmentation of Vessels in 3D Images , 1997, Scale-Space.

[15]  Edward H. Adelson,et al.  The Design and Use of Steerable Filters , 1991, IEEE Trans. Pattern Anal. Mach. Intell..

[16]  Guillermo Sapiro,et al.  Geodesic Active Contours , 1995, International Journal of Computer Vision.

[17]  Jean Daunizeau,et al.  Accurate Anisotropic Fast Marching for Diffusion-Based Geodesic Tractography , 2007, Int. J. Biomed. Imaging.

[18]  Guido Gerig,et al.  Three-dimensional multi-scale line filter for segmentation and visualization of curvilinear structures in medical images , 1998, Medical Image Anal..

[19]  Alfred M. Bruckstein,et al.  Regularized Laplacian Zero Crossings as Optimal Edge Integrators , 2003, International Journal of Computer Vision.

[20]  Anthony J. Yezzi,et al.  Vessels as 4D Curves: Global Minimal 4D Paths to Extract 3D Tubular Surfaces , 2006, 2006 Conference on Computer Vision and Pattern Recognition Workshop (CVPRW'06).

[21]  W. D. Evans,et al.  PARTIAL DIFFERENTIAL EQUATIONS , 1941 .

[22]  R. M. Natal Jorge,et al.  Advances in Computational Vision and Medical Image Processing , 2009 .

[23]  Alejandro F. Frangi,et al.  Muliscale Vessel Enhancement Filtering , 1998, MICCAI.

[24]  Maxime Descoteaux,et al.  A geometric flow for segmenting vasculature in proton-density weighted MRI , 2008, Medical Image Anal..

[25]  Max W. K. Law,et al.  Three Dimensional Curvilinear Structure Detection Using Optimally Oriented Flux , 2008, ECCV.

[26]  Isabelle E. Magnin,et al.  Evaluation of semi-automatic arterial stenosis quantification , 2006, International Journal of Computer Assisted Radiology and Surgery.

[27]  Hongen Liao,et al.  Anisotropic Haralick Edge Detection Scheme with Application to Vessel Segmentation , 2008, MIAR.

[28]  Pierrick Coupé,et al.  3D Wavelet Subbands Mixing for Image Denoising , 2008, Int. J. Biomed. Imaging.

[29]  Mathews Jacob,et al.  Design of steerable filters for feature detection using canny-like criteria , 2004,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[30]  Shiing-Shen Chern,et al.  Finsler Geometry Is Just Riemannian Geometry without the Quadratic Restriction , 1997 .

[31]  F. Bornemann,et al.  Finite-element Discretization of Static Hamilton-Jacobi Equations based on a Local Variational Principle , 2004, math/0403517.

[32]  Hongen Liao,et al.  R-PLUS: A Riemannian Anisotropic Edge Detection Scheme for Vascular Segmentation , 2008, MICCAI.

[33]  Laurent D. Cohen,et al.  Global Minimum for Active Contour Models: A Minimal Path Approach , 1997, International Journal of Computer Vision.

[34]  Max W. K. Law,et al.  Weighted Local Variance-Based Edge Detection and Its Application to Vascular Segmentation in Magnetic Resonance Angiography , 2007, IEEE Transactions on Medical Imaging.

[35]  Tony Lindeberg,et al.  Edge Detection and Ridge Detection with Automatic Scale Selection , 1996, Proceedings CVPR I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[36]  D L Chopp Replacing iterative algorithms with single-pass algorithms , 2001, Proceedings of the National Academy of Sciences of the United States of America.

[37]  Anthony J. Yezzi,et al.  Vessel Segmentation Using a Shape Driven Flow , 2004, MICCAI.

[38]  Leo Joskowicz,et al.  Carotid Lumen Segmentation and Stenosis Grading Challenge , 2010, The MIDAS Journal.

[39]  Qingfen Lin,et al.  Enhancement, Extraction, and Visualization of 3D Volume Data , 2001 .

[40]  Guillermo Sapiro,et al.  New Possibilities with Sobolev Active Contours , 2007, SSVM.

[41]  Kaleem Siddiqi,et al.  3D Flux Maximizing Flows , 2001, EMMCVPR.

[42]  Marc Niethammer,et al.  Tubular Surface Evolution for Segmentation of the Cingulum Bundle From DW-MRI , 2008 .

[43]  J. Tsitsiklis,et al.  Efficient algorithms for globally optimal trajectories , 1994, Proceedings of 1994 33rd IEEE Conference on Decision and Control.

[44]  Ron Kimmel,et al.  Segmentation of thin structures in volumetric medical images , 2006, IEEE Transactions on Image Processing.

[45]  OrkiszMaciej,et al.  Models, algorithms and applications in vascular image segmentation , 2008 .

[46]  L. Evans,et al.  Partial Differential Equations , 1941 .

[47]  L. Cohen,et al.  Segmentation of 3D tubular objects with adaptive front propagation and minimal tree extraction for 3D medical imaging , 2007, Computer methods in biomechanics and biomedical engineering.

[48]  Edsger W. Dijkstra,et al.  A note on two problems in connexion with graphs , 1959, Numerische Mathematik.

[49]  Max A. Viergever,et al.  Vessel Axis Tracking Using Topology Constrained Surface Evolution , 2007, IEEE Transactions on Medical Imaging.

[50]  Francis K. H. Quek,et al.  A review of vessel extraction techniques and algorithms , 2004, CSUR.

[51]  Laurent D. Cohen,et al.  Tubular Anisotropy Segmentation , 2009, SSVM.

[52]  Marcela Hernández Hoyos,et al.  Models, algorithms and applications in vascular image segmentation , 2008 .

[53]  Alexander M. Bronstein,et al.  Parallel algorithms for approximation of distance maps on parametric surfaces , 2008, TOGS.

[54]  K. Castleman,et al.  Flux-based anisotropic diffusion applied to enhancement of 3-D angiogram , 2002 .

[55]  Hervé Delingette,et al.  A Recursive Anisotropic Fast Marching Approach to Reaction Diffusion Equation: Application to Tumor Growth Modeling , 2007, IPMI.

[56]  Laurent D. Cohen,et al.  Carotid Lumen Segmentation Based on Tubular Anisotropy and Contours Without Edges , 2009, The MIDAS Journal.

[57]  Rachid Deriche,et al.  Brain Connectivity Mapping Using Riemannian Geometry, Control Theory, and PDEs , 2009, SIAM J. Imaging Sci..

[58]  Ross T. Whitaker,et al.  Anisotropic Curvature Motion for Structure Enhancing Smoothing of 3D MR Angiography Data , 2007, Journal of Mathematical Imaging and Vision.

[59]  Isabelle Bloch,et al.  A review of 3D vessel lumen segmentation techniques: Models, features and extraction schemes , 2009, Medical Image Anal..

[60]  Sigurd B. Angenent,et al.  Finsler Active Contours , 2008,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[61]  Jürgen Weese,et al.  Multi-scale line segmentation with automatic estimation of width, contrast and tangential direction in 2D and 3D medical images , 1997, CVRMed.

[62]  Laurent D. Cohen,et al.  Fast extraction of tubular and tree 3D surfaces with front propagation methods , 2002, Object recognition supported by user interaction for service robots.

[63]  Guillermo Sapiro,et al.  New Possibilities with Sobolev Active Contours , 2007, International Journal of Computer Vision.

[64]  Jerry L. Prince,et al.  An active contour model for mapping the cortex , 1995, IEEE Trans. Medical Imaging.